Fig. 1: Correlations among different measurements of NAbs and IgG against SARS-CoV-2.

From: Dynamics of neutralizing antibody responses to SARS-CoV-2 in patients with COVID-19: an observational study

Fig. 1

A NAbs IC50 titer by focus reduction neutralization test (FRNT) vs NAbs IC50 titer by surrogate virus neutralization test (sVNT); B NAbs IC50 titer by FRNT vs logit of sVNT neutralization rate at 1:20 dilution of sera (logit NR20); C NAbs IC50 titer by sVNT vs logit NR20; D NAbs IC50 titer by FRNT vs the level of total binding IgG. The blue lines are the regression lines between two measurements estimated by Deming regression. ρ Spearman’s correlation coefficients, S/CO ratio of the chemiluminescence signal over the cutoff value
